Moshood’s well-attended celebration was simply spectacular and fashions were bold, opulent, vibrant, and colorful.
The looks were a fabulous mix of African chic and timeless elegance with modern modes. Fashion coordinator Michael Williams, a top accessories designer, jazzed-up Moshood’s designs with sharp accessories, including spiked heels and jewelry. Williams specializes in belts and has created belts for Stevie Wonder and other top entertainers.
The music pumped up the volume at the spot, featuring a live, electrifying steel drum performance by DoMoJOAT Steel Band Drummers, Corner Stone Band, and Dale Charles BedStuy “Gateway” BID. The rocking runway music was provided by DJ Barry Blends. But Moshood’s African-inspired fashion collection was the star of the show, featuring exceptional models who strutted their stuff. “Make yourself at home,” greeted Moshood, upon my arrival at his shop before the show.
